U.S. ETF Assets Grow In March, But Net Flow Slows

Otmane El Rhazi from Investor's Business Daily - ETFs RSS.

Assets of all exchange traded funds rose 0.1% in March to $2.063 trillion. Over the past 12 months, ETF assets increased $352.43 billion, or 21%. But net inflow slowed in March to $26.72 billion from $32.71 billion in February. Investors parked $21.84 billion in global and international ETFs in March. By comparison, domestic equity funds absorbed $6.15 billion. Small-cap and health care funds drew strong net inflow of $3 billion and $2.86 billion

Actively Managed ETFs Grow Quickly But Face Hurdles

Otmane El Rhazi from Investor's Business Daily - ETFs RSS.



Actively managed exchange traded funds are a small but fast-growing segment of the approximately $2 trillion ETF industry. But regulatory hurdles threaten to stunt their growth. Like traditional mutual funds, actively managed ETFs harness the buy and sell ideas of professional money managers who aim to outperform a benchmark index. But, unlike mutual funds, the ETFs allow investors to manage short-term risks by trading intraday and using tools

Hottest ETF Strategy: Factor Investing In Stocks

Otmane El Rhazi from Investor's Business Daily - ETFs RSS.



Factor investing is in. The term refers to ETFs that focus on stocks that share specific characteristics, or factors. Various market researchers have concluded that those factors are keys to outperformance. So certain ETF operators are trying to tilt the playing field in their favor by using indexes that favor those factors. Schwab Disrupts ETF Industry And Plans To Keep At It

Otmane El Rhazi from Investor's Business Daily - ETFs RSS.



Schwab ETFs are growing fast. In just over five years, Schwab's 21 exchange traded funds have captured $30 billion in assets and 1.5% of total market share. It's now the seventh largest ETF provider in asset size, up from 10th a year ago. John Sturiale, a senior vice president at Charles Schwab (SCHW) Investment Management (CSIM), helped craft the brokerage's target retirement date funds in 2002. Comparing ETFs? Don't Just Look At Expense Ratios

Otmane El Rhazi from Investor's Business Daily - ETFs RSS.



The rule when buying ETFs is that when all things are equal, buy the one with the lowest expense ratio. But remember that similar sounding ETFs often aren't equal. This means don't let the expense ratio be the only factor in choosing an ETF. "Our belief is expenses and past performance matter, but more important is understanding what's inside the portfolio," said Todd Rosenbluth, S&P Capital IQ director of ETF research.
